Introduction to Dental Veneers

Understanding Dental Veneers

Dental veneers are thin, custom-made shells placed on the front surface of teeth to improve their appearance. They are commonly used to address issues such as discoloration, misalignment, and chipped teeth. Veneers can be made from porcelain or composite resin, each with its unique advantages.

Exploring the Benefits of Choosing Asian Countries

Affordability and Cost Savings

One of the primary reasons patients opt for dental veneers in Asia is the significant cost savings. Compared to Western countries, Asian countries offer competitive prices without compromising on quality. This affordability extends to the cost of materials, labor, and overall treatment expenses.

High-Quality Dental Care

Asian countries boast world-class dental facilities equipped with modern technology and experienced dentists. Many dental professionals in Asia have received international training and certifications, ensuring top-notch care for patients seeking dental veneers.

Scenic Destinations and Tourism Opportunities

Medical tourists undergoing dental veneer procedures in Asia can enjoy the added benefit of exploring beautiful and culturally rich destinations. Countries like Thailand, India, and Malaysia offer patients the opportunity to combine their dental treatment with a memorable vacation experience.

Accessibility and Convenience

Asian countries are well-connected globally, making it convenient for international patients to travel for dental veneer treatments. Airports, transportation infrastructure, and ease of obtaining medical visas contribute to the accessibility of these destinations.

Top Asian Destinations for Dental Veneers

Thailand

Thailand has gained a reputation as a leading dental tourism destination, with a plethora of dental clinics offering high-quality veneer treatments. Patients are drawn to Thailand not only for its affordable prices but also for its vibrant culture and picturesque beaches.

India

India is known for its skilled dental professionals and state-of-the-art dental facilities. Dental veneer treatments in India are cost-effective, and patients can explore the country's rich heritage and diverse landscapes.

Malaysia

Malaysia offers a unique blend of modernity and natural beauty. Dental tourists can expect excellent veneer treatments in Malaysia, complemented by the opportunity to explore its lush rainforests and bustling cities.

Vietnam

Vietnam has emerged as a hidden gem for dental veneer procedures. With its competitive pricing and a growing number of dental clinics, Vietnam provides a compelling option for international patients.

Philippines

The Philippines is renowned for its hospitality and pristine beaches. Dental veneer treatments in this country are both affordable and of high quality, making it an attractive destination for medical tourists.
